Output 6385e95deacb2a19d3618340c07c4d1a61f3b99d8d836458069d22ef7158e3e5:0

value
3161872941
script pubkey
OP_0 OP_PUSHBYTES_20 d1da8f1b588567897631c06bbb493416d2c63c3a
address
tb1q68dg7x6cs4ncja33cp4mkjf5zmfvv0p6zglnr8
transaction
6385e95deacb2a19d3618340c07c4d1a61f3b99d8d836458069d22ef7158e3e5
spent
true